[v6,6/9] vhost: always take IOTLB lock
Checks
Commit Message
clang does not support conditionally held locks when statically analysing
taken locks with thread safety checks.
Always take iotlb locks regardless of VIRTIO_F_IOMMU_PLATFORM feature.
Signed-off-by: David Marchand <david.marchand@redhat.com>
Acked-by: Morten Brørup <mb@smartsharesystems.com>
Reviewed-by: Maxime Coquelin <maxime.coquelin@redhat.com>
---
lib/vhost/vhost.c | 8 +++-----
lib/vhost/virtio_net.c | 24 ++++++++----------------
2 files changed, 11 insertions(+), 21 deletions(-)
